Şti.’nin yıllar içinde edindiği ithalat, üretim, tedarik ve tasarım tecrübesinin dijital yansımasıdır. Platform; koleksiyon ürünleri, 3D baskı figürler, el yapımı örgü oyuncaklar, metal model arabalar, vintage ve dekoratif ürünler, sanat ve tasarım objeleri gibi farklı kategorilerde seçkin ürünleri bir araya getirir. DeküptenAl’ın temel amacı; seri üretimden uzak, hikâyesi olan, koleksiyon değeri taşıyan ve hediye edilebilirliği yüksek ürünleri kullanıcılarla buluşturmaktır. Deküp Ltd. Şti. ve DeküptenAl; ürün seçiminde kalite, açıklamalarda şeffaflık ve kullanıcı deneyiminde güvenilirliği öncelik olarak benimser. Koleksiyon dünyasından robotik eğitime uzanan geniş uzmanlık alanı sayesinde, hem bireysel koleksiyonerlere hem de kurumsal yapılara hitap eden sürdürülebilir bir yapı sunar. DeküptenAl, farklı dünyaları bir araya getiren, merak eden, üreten ve keşfetmeyi seven herkes için oluşturulmuş bir platformdur.
